About #F86600

The precise color #F86600 is an excellent choice for modern design projects. Designers often compare it to the standard color Orangered. This translates to an RGB value of rgb(248, 102, 0).

If you are designing for print, the four-color process is what matters most. This specific hue requires a mix of 0% C, 59% M, 100% Y, and 3% K. Always request a physical proof before doing a large print run with this exact code.

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) dictate how we should use this color. Because it is a medium color, it is generally recommended to use #000000 text. Strict adherence to these ratios protects visually impaired users from unreadable interfaces.

Color Space Conversions

HEX#F86600
RGB248, 102, 0
HSL24.7°, 100.0%, 48.6%
CMYK0%, 59%, 100%, 3%
HSV24.7°, 100.0%, 97.3%
LAB61.2, 52.5, 70.1
XYZ43.5, 29.5, 3.4
Decimal16279040
